UFV and Sabadell: V Financial Advisor Course for religious entities and the third sector

In its V edition, the Financial Advisor Online Course of the Graduate School of the Francisco de Vitoria University and Banco Sabadell, allows to reinforce a specialized knowledge of Religious Institutions and Third Sector Entities.

The V edition of the Financial Advisor Course for Religious and Third Sector Entities began on February 26, 2026. It is a one hundred percent online course, developed between Banco Sabadell and the Francisco de Vitoria University, which aims to be a solid pillar for the day-to-day management of administrators and bursars.

This university certification offers a complete and rigorous training to professionals and collaborators of the sector, with the objective of reinforcing the specialized knowledge of these institutions and helping to provide knowledge and tools to their administrators, with a vision very focused on their sustainability, always putting people at the center.

Enrollment is open until June 22, 2026.

The enrollment period began on December 15, 2025 and will be open until June 22, 2026, concluding the program on December 31, 2026. Upon completion, students will be awarded the Universidad Francisco de Vitoria's own degree.

As mentioned above, it is a 100% online course, with 12 ECTS. It is also accompanied by tutorials conducted by specialists in Religious Institutions and Third Sector Entities of the Banco Sabadell. It is a training open to professionals from all sectors, offering a scholarship plan of up to 80% in tuition for staff and managers of Religious Institutions and Third Sector Entities BS clients, as well as BS employees.

Specialized knowledge

This advanced online course is adapted to the reality of professionals and offers a complete and rigorous training with the objective of reinforcing a specialized knowledge of Religious Institutions and Third Sector Entities.

Throughout the four previous editions, a total of 1,159 students have enrolled, of which 730 have completed the course and obtained the degree from the Universidad Francisco de Vitoria.

Material updated by professionals and teachers

By means of a dynamic and interactive tool, the course allows the student to follow the course adapting it to each personal and professional situation. The material has been prepared and updated by active professionals in the financial sector and professors of the Universidad Francisco de Vitoria who combine teaching with their professional activity, providing the course with the highest academic and pedagogical quality.
